Key Features to Look For
You need to know what makes a good auto vacuum. Here are some important things to consider:
- Suction Power: This is the most important thing! Strong suction means it picks up dirt and crumbs better. Look for vacuums with high air watts (AW) or Pascal (Pa) ratings. Higher numbers mean more power.
- Corded vs. Cordless: Corded vacuums plug into your car’s cigarette lighter. They have continuous power. Cordless vacuums run on batteries. They are easier to move around, but they need to be charged.
- Attachments: Different attachments help you clean different areas. Look for a crevice tool for tight spaces, a brush for seats, and maybe an extension hose.
- Dustbin Size: A bigger dustbin means you don’t have to empty it as often.
- Filters: Good filters trap dust and allergens. Look for HEPA filters. They are really good at cleaning the air.
- Weight and Size: A lightweight and compact vacuum is easier to handle and store.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What is the best type of auto vacuum?
A: The best type depends on your needs. Corded vacuums have more power. Cordless vacuums are more convenient.
Q: How do I choose the right suction power?
A: Look for vacuums with high air watts (AW) or Pascal (Pa) ratings. The higher the number, the better the suction.
Q: What attachments do I need?
A: A crevice tool is great for tight spaces. A brush is good for seats. An extension hose helps you reach further.
Q: How often should I empty the dustbin?
A: Empty the dustbin when it’s full. This keeps your vacuum working well.
Q: How do I clean the filters?
A: Follow the manufacturer’s instructions. Usually, you can rinse them with water or replace them.
Q: Are cordless vacuums as powerful as corded ones?
A: Corded vacuums usually have more power. But cordless vacuums are getting better all the time.
Q: How long does the battery last on a cordless vacuum?
A: Battery life varies. Check the specifications before you buy. Look for at least 15-20 minutes of run time.
Q: Can I use an auto vacuum on wet surfaces?
A: Most auto vacuums are for dry use only. Check the product description.
